About this work

Procession from San Marco over the Piazzetta (the section of Piazza San Marco between the Doge's Palace and the Biblioteca Marciana). The procession moves toward the Grand Canal. At the water stand the two columns with the statues of Saint Theodore of Amasea and the lion of Saint Mark. Two-line Italian text in the lower margin. The print is part of an album.
